editorconfig-maven-plugin requires Java 8+ and Maven 3.3.1+.
To make the build fail if any of your source files does not comply with .editorconfig rules, add the following to your project:
<plugin> <groupId>org.ec4j.maven</groupId> <artifactId>editorconfig-maven-plugin</artifactId> <version>0.2.0</version> <executions> <execution> <id>check</id> <phase>verify</phase> <goals> <goal>check</goal> </goals> </execution> </executions> <configuration> <!-- See http://ec4j.github.io/editorconfig-maven-plugin/ for full configuration reference --> <excludes> <!-- Note that maven submodule directories and many non-source file patterns are excluded by default --> <!-- see https://github.com/ec4j/editorconfig-linters/blob/master/editorconfig-lint-api/src/main/java/org/ec4j/lint/api/Constants.java#L37 --> <!-- You can exclude further files from processing: --> <exclude>src/main/**/*.whatever</exclude> </excludes> <!-- All files are included by default: <includes> <include>**</include> </includes> --> </configuration> </plugin>
